关系数据库是一种常用的数据库模型,用于组织和存储结构化数据。下面是关系数据库的一些基本概念:
表(Table):
表是关系数据库中最基本的组织单元,用于存储数据。表由行(Row)和列(Column)组成,行表示数据的具体实例,列表示数据的属性或字段。
主键(Primary Key):
数据库属性的概念主键是表中唯一标识每一行数据的列或列组合。主键的值必须在表中是唯一且非空的,用于区分和引用表中的不同行。
外键(Foreign Key):
外键是一个表中的列,用于引用另一个表中的主键。外键用于建立表之间的关联关系,实现数据之间的参照完整性和一致性。
关系(Relation):
关系是指表之间的连接和关联。通过主键和外键的关系,可以建立表之间的关联关系,实现数据的关联查询和联接操作。
视图(View):
视图是从一个或多个表中导出的虚拟表,它基于特定的查询定义。视图可以根据需要定义,用于简化数据访问和数据处理。
索引(Index):
索引是一种数据结构,用于加快数据检索的速度。它通过创建一个特定的数据结构,以提供对表中数据的快速访问路径。
范式(Normalization):
范式是一种关系数据库设计的理论原则,旨在消除数据冗余和提高数据的一致性。范式包括一系列规范化级别(1NF、2NF、3NF等),每个级别都有其特定的要求和目标。
以上是关系数据库的一些基本概念。关系数据库的设计和使用可以根据具体的需求和情况
进行调整和扩展。关系数据库管理系统(RDBMS)如MySQL、Oracle、SQL Server等,提供了强大的功能和工具,用于管理和操作关系数据库中的数据。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论